SalesAgent Chat vs. Taskade: Choosing the Right AI Agent for Your Workflow

In the rapidly evolving landscape of AI-powered productivity, the choice between a specialized tool and a versatile workspace can define your team's efficiency. SalesAgent Chat and Taskade represent two distinct philosophies in the AI agent space. While SalesAgent Chat focuses on high-stakes, real-time sales interactions, Taskade offers a comprehensive environment for building autonomous agents that manage entire projects. This comparison explores which tool is the right investment for your specific business needs.

SalesAgent Chat Overview

SalesAgent Chat is a specialized AI Sales Copilot designed to sit alongside sales professionals during live interactions. Unlike general-purpose AI, it is trained specifically on sales psychology, objection handling, and lead qualification. Its primary goal is to provide real-time suggestions during calls or chats, helping reps navigate difficult questions and refine their pitch on the fly. It functions as a digital "ride-along" coach that ensures brand consistency and increases the likelihood of closing deals by surfacing relevant data and persuasive responses exactly when they are needed.

Taskade Overview

Taskade is a unified productivity workspace that has transformed from a simple task list into a robust "AI Agent" platform. It allows users to build, train, and deploy autonomous AI agents that live within their project folders. These agents can be trained on specific company documents, websites, and files to perform a variety of roles—from project managers and researchers to content creators. Taskade’s strength lies in its "Workspace DNA," where agents, tasks, mind maps, and team collaboration tools are all interconnected, allowing for complex workflow automation that runs 24/7 without human intervention.

Detailed Feature Comparison

The fundamental difference between these two tools lies in their operational timing: Real-time vs. Asynchronous. SalesAgent Chat is built for the "heat of the moment." It listens to live audio or reads incoming chat messages to provide instant feedback. Its features are laser-focused on the sales funnel, such as generating prospect-specific questions and analyzing the sentiment of a conversation. It is a reactive tool designed to augment human performance during high-pressure communication.

In contrast, Taskade is built for systemic execution. Its AI agents are designed to work while you sleep. You can create a "Sales Agent" in Taskade, but its role would be more about lead research, drafting email sequences, or updating CRM tasks rather than coaching you during a live call. Taskade’s multi-agent system allows different AI personas to collaborate with each other—for example, a "Researcher Agent" can find prospect data and hand it off to a "Copywriter Agent" to draft a proposal, all within the same workspace.

From an integration standpoint, SalesAgent Chat typically plugs into communication channels like Zoom, Google Meet, or CRM-linked dialers. Taskade, however, serves as the central hub itself. It replaces multiple tools by combining chat, video conferencing, and task management into one interface. While SalesAgent Chat excels at the "narrow" task of sales enablement, Taskade offers a "broad" platform where you can build custom tools for marketing, operations, and HR alongside your sales workflows.

Pricing Comparison

  • SalesAgent Chat: Pricing is generally tailored to sales teams and often requires a demo or contact with their sales department for a custom quote. This reflect its positioning as a high-ROI tool for professional sales organizations where even a slight increase in close rates justifies a premium price point.
  • Taskade: Offers a transparent, tiered model.
    • Free: 1,000 AI credits per month, basic task management.
    • Starter ($6/mo): Up to 3 users, 10,000 AI credits, and unlimited workspaces.
    • Pro ($16/mo): Up to 10 users, 50,000 AI credits, and the ability to train agents on your own data.
    • Business ($40/mo): Unlimited users, 150,000 AI credits, and advanced white-labeling features.

The Verdict

The choice between SalesAgent Chat and Taskade depends entirely on your role. If you are a Sales Professional whose success is measured by call performance and closing rates, SalesAgent Chat is the superior choice; its real-time specialized intelligence provides a competitive edge that general tools cannot match. However, for Project Managers and Business Owners who need to organize complex workflows and automate team operations, Taskade is the clear winner. Taskade’s ability to build a custom "digital workforce" of autonomous agents makes it one of the most versatile productivity tools on the market today.
